Jeremiah 31:24

KJV ORIGINAL
And there shall dwell in Judah itself, and in all the cities thereof together, husbandmen, and they that go forth with flocks.

✦ MADE SIMPLE

And people will live in Judah and in all its cities together—farmers and shepherds who tend their flocks.

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

This verse promises that people will return to live peacefully in their homeland, working the land and caring for livestock as they once did.

📚 Historical Context

This verse comes from Jeremiah's prophecy about the restoration of Israel after the Babylonian exile. The Jewish people had been torn from their land and taken captive to Babylon, leaving their cities empty and their agricultural way of life disrupted. Jeremiah is prophesying about a future time when God would bring His people back to rebuild and repopulate their homeland.
